Output 25e823bd60f2c516bd9c9ffb5c7f650087706658b5cc6c971ebf9798bc05a2c3:1

value
1504822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f93aed1efb46a65ff4d1eaa8d4e90fd183a233 OP_EQUAL
address
3M77k2bbFAgP8TTCwgPSNfLpEz52TZ9afE
transaction
25e823bd60f2c516bd9c9ffb5c7f650087706658b5cc6c971ebf9798bc05a2c3
spent
true